After being away from HardLight for almost a year I came back and started working on a new campaign that I had started before I left. After two weeks of finishing up parts of the missions its ready to be released.

Utopia - Return to Neo-Terra (Part 1) is an 11 mission FS2 campaign telling the tale of increased Piracy in Polaris and how Alpha 1 is linked to it. Set three years after Capella you'll encounter new friends, old foes and a person thought to be dead.

Built using FS2 retail, but fully functional under Freespace Open.
